Google Maps嵌入链接有时可用,有时不可用(onebox 404)

我遇到了一个关于 Google Maps 链接的奇怪行为。

有时它们能正常嵌入,有时 onebox 请求会返回 404。我找不到一致重现该问题的方法,但这种情况非常频繁。试试粘贴链接、移动谷歌地图相机或裁剪、再试一次等等……

起初我以为是速率限制,但事实并非如此。有效的链接和无效的链接在这里或在我的论坛上是相同的。例如:

有人知道这个问题出在哪里吗?是谷歌方面的问题?还是 Discourse 方面的问题?应该把它移到 Bug 吗?

5 个赞

这有点奇怪,我刚注意到这个模式……但我觉得它与链接中的缩放级别有关?

:x: 15.5z

:white_check_mark: 15z

:x: 16.75z

:white_check_mark: 17z

一个完全不同的位置……

:x: 15.38z

:white_check_mark: 15z

我猜是我们这边的 Google Maps onebox 引擎有问题?

8 个赞

干得漂亮 @awesomerobot:man_detective:

看起来我们的缩放级别正则表达式不允许此处出现点号:

修复起来相当容易。

9 个赞

太棒了 :smiley:

谢谢你弄清楚了!

2 个赞

@loic 你能快速看一下这个吗?

1 个赞

好的,我来看看 :slight_smile:

已修复:

6 个赞

正在重建 @awesomerobot 的帖子,所有的 Google 地图链接现在都可以正常工作了 :clap:
关闭此问题。

6 个赞